Hi HN! I am an undergrad student trying to build interesting things with AI. Recently, I was looking for a dataset I could use for a new project. I realized that it is really frustrating to go through all the government websites (with terrible UX) just to find some usable dataset. I set out to build a GitHub for datasets, named DataHub. Right now, we have more than 1000 datasets from Montréal and New York City, with more cities coming soon (and possible government agencies). All of this is wrapped into a powerful search. It's a breeze to find a dataset to work on. I'd be interested to know…

Ryd.io As a capstone project for Galvanize's data science immersive I took another look at the NYC Taxi data set. A ton of analysis has been done on individual rides/cars and I was curious about what story would be told by looking at this data through the aggregate. Through the clustered map you can identify different 'personalities' of the city with a birds eye view. Check it out here http://ryd.io/cluster_map I've just spent past couple weeks working hard on this project and would love to talk to anyone about it if they are interested.
